Joker is #1 in Comic Vine's Top 100 Super Villains 2011

Who got the last laugh? Joker of course.

(please log in to view the image)

Joker has proven himself that he is one of the greatest villains in comics history as he took the top spot in Comic Vine's Top 100 Super villains 2011.

Who wouldn't recognize him when he's simply Batman's greatest foe.
(please log in to view the image)

Meanwhile, Lex Luthor is #2 and Magneto secured the #3 spot.

104 comic vine members participated the annual poll which is being conducted by the Comic Vine community

Thanos' self loathing and pathos is what makes him a pretty interesting character. Really, in terms of villainy, he should be in the top ten at least.

And his plot was actually pretty sound, all things considered. He used Loki as a pawn to obtain the Terrasect, effectively loaning him the Chitauri army and letting him keep Earth should he succeed. Thanos and Loki weren't expecting humanity to band together in the form of the Avengers, which ironically assembled in the first place to stop their plan. After learning that Earth did have a line of defense and challenging them would be to "court death", I can only imagine that's right up Thanos' alley.
